Driver Rehab Program Helps Patients Return to the Road

Published: Nov. 10, 2015

A growing program is helping people with major medical issues get back on their feet and on the road.

The Driver Rehab program is one of only a few in the whole state where they put drivers into a car.

David Newell, of La Vista, has spent the majority of 2015 learning what he calls a “new normal” after having an unexpected allergic reaction.

KMTV reporter Lindsey Theis sat down with Kelina Moore, coordinator of the Methodist Hospital driver rehabilitation program, to learn more about how the program is helping clients get back on the road.
